Yeah, the Goetze rumors seem to be credible, I think there is serious interest, although I haven't heard anything concrete that might suggest that it's even close to a done deal or anything like that. It makes sense, reuniting with Klopp and all that. Lewa and Reus do not make sense ... why would either leave? I never heard any credible rumors that they would.

But I don't know if Klopp is necessarily going to make a big splash in the transfer market in terms of name-brand players. I get the impression that he is more of a builder than a buyer.

I recall that he said this at his introductory press conference:

Asked whether Liverpool could attract a player of the calibre of Marco Reus without Champions League football, having failed to entice several targets during Rodgers’ reign, Klopp replied: “I absolutely don’t care about this.

“If we cannot sign a player like him then we are not interested in him. We will have to take other players. The whole world plays football, there are players everywhere.

“It is only here that money is such a big thing. It is money, money, money. OK, there is much money. You don’t have to spend all the money. You can hold it and make something else. Of course, not having Champions League football is a problem, it is a negative. Of course, it should be a target for all ambitious teams to play in the Champions League, for sure. But only four go in. You have to fight for it, not just talk about it. You don’t have to speak always.

“You have to look at which players are reachable and not dream of this player or that player and then say: ‘But they don’t want to come to Liverpool.’ If a player doesn’t want to come to Liverpool then stay away. Really. If you think about the weather, stay away. If you think about other things, stay away. If you want to come here, you are welcome. That is the first and most important issue.”
